Who created the idea of birthstones? Experts believe that birthstones can be traced back to the Bible. In Exodus 28, Moses sets forth directions for making special garments for Aaron, the High Priest of the Hebrews. Specifically, the breastplate was to contain twelve precious gemstones, representing the twelve tribes of Israel.

JANUARY BIRTHSTONE GARNET MEANING & HISTORY The name garnet originates from the medieval Latin granatus, meaning pomegranate, in reference to the similarity of the red color. Garnets have been used since the Bronze Age as gemstones and abrasives. Necklaces studded with red garnets adorned the pharaohs of ancient Egypt. Signet rings in ancient Rome featured garnet intaglios that were used to stamp the wax that secured important documents. The clergy and nobility of the M...iddle Ages had a preference for red garnets. Garnet is actually a group of several minerals. Five of these pyrope, almandine, spessartine, grossular and andradite are important as gems. Pyrope and almandine range from purple to red. Spessartine is found in exciting oranges and yellows, while andradite is mostly yellow to green (the gem variety demantoid). Grossular may have the widest range, from colorless through yellow to reddish orange and orangy red, as well as a strong vibrant green called tsavorite. The Smithsonian’s antique pyrope hair comb is one of the most famous pieces of garnet jewelry (pyrope is from the Greek pyrpos, which means fiery-eyed). A large rose-cut garnet sits at the crest, much like a queen serenely surveying her court. The pyrope garnets that decorate this tiara-like jewel came from the historic mines in Bohemia (now part of the Czech Republic), and these rich red beauties were extremely popular during the Victorian era (18371901), when this piece was fashioned.

DIAMOND CLARITY: FL No surface imperfections or inclusions; the rarest of all diamonds. IF... No visible inclusions, even under magnification. VVS1 No imperfections visible to the unaided eye. VVS2 No imperfections visible to the unaided eye. VS1 At VSI, you may be able to see a few tiny imperfections upon close inspection. VS2 At VS2, you might be able to see a few more tiny inclusions. SI1 Imperfections, though small, are likely to be visible with the unaided eye. SI2 Imperfections, though small, are likely to be visible with the unaided eye. See more

DIAMOND COLOR: Colorless D Colorless; appears completely white under 10 times magnification and pairs well with platinum, palladium, and white gold. Colorless E Colorless; can only be distinguished from D by a gemologist and pairs well with platinum, palladium, and white gold.... Colorless F Colorless; can only be distinguished from D and E by a gemologist and pairs well with platinum, palladium, and white gold. Near Colorless G Near Colorless; extremely subtle hints of yellow noticeable only in side-by-side comparison and pairs well with white or yellow gold. Near Colorless H Near Colorless; subtle hints of yellow visible in side-by-side comparison and pairs well with white or yellow gold. Near Colorless I Near Colorless; subtle hints of yellow noticeable with the unaided eye and pairs well with white or yellow gold. Near Colorless J Near Colorless; subtle hints of yellow noticeable with the unaided eye and pairs well with white or yellow gold. Faint Yellow K Faint Yellow; appears yellow without magnification and pairs well with yellow gold. Faint Yellow L Faint Yellow; appears yellow without magnification and pairs well with yellow gold. Buying tip: Cut grade is especially important for square and rectangular diamonds, such as princess, Asscher, radiant and emerald shapes. With these shapes, a Very Good cut grade will ensure a consistent, stunning sparkle and an even distribution of carat weight.

Choosing Your Carat Weight When you’re ready to choose a carat weight for your diamond, remember that size is not everything cut grade strongly affects the quality and beauty of your diamond; color and clarity grades do so too (though to a lesser degree). For the best value, consider diamonds slightly lighter than the carat weight you initially had in mind. For example, if you are thinking about purchasing a 1 carat diamond, consider diamonds at 0.95 to 0.99 carats as well. The difference in visual size will be negligible, but the savings can be significant. You can use those savings to invest in a higher cut grade or a more lavish ring setting.

#4 Carat Carat is the measure of how much a diamond weighs. Carat is also related to size (how big a diamond looks), although it’s not the only factor that determines size. Depending on shape, weight distribution and cut quality, two diamonds with the same carat weight can be different sizes. It’s worth noting that some diamonds are cut solely with an emphasis on weight. These gems can sacrifice brilliance and symmetry in favor of delivering a larger carat figure. #3 Color Though it may seem counterintuitive, a diamond’s color grade actually measures how little color it reflects. The diamond color grading scale begins with D and ranges down to Z. A diamond assigned a grade of D has absolutely no color -- it looks pure white, even to a gemologist inspecting it carefully under 10X magnification. On the other hand, a diamond assigned a grade of Z looks yellow or brownish.

#2 Clarity Clarity refers to a diamond’s natural inclusions, or lack thereof. While small marks within a diamond are natural, their appearance can leave something to be desired if they are visible to the unaided eye. The shape of a diamond can affect the importance of its clarity grade. The facet patterns of the brilliant-cut diamond shapes such as round and princess can hide certain imperfections, but step-cut shapes such as emerald and Asscher have large, open tables that m...ake inclusions more obvious. The 4 C's of Diamonds The 4 Cs, as they are known within the jewelry industry, are the standard way to measure the beauty, craftsmanship and value of a diamond. #1 Cut The term diamond cut refers to the quality of a diamond’s proportions and symmetry. These elements determine how much light a diamond captures and reflects, and therefore how much it sparkles. This is a direct result of the skill of the craftsman who shaped and cut the diamond.... There are four grades of diamond cut: Ideal, Very Good, Good and Poor. If you compare two diamonds of different cuts grades, you will see that the higher cut grade has significantly more sparkle. There will also be a difference in their prices, with the better cut grade commanding a higher price. Of the 4 Cs, cut is generally recognized as the most important, since it has the greatest impact on a diamond’s appearance and quality.
